Akkineni Brothers, Naga Chaitanya and Akhil Akkineni, have a funny and very rare coincidence with their latest films’ North America box office performances.

Thandel underperformed and ended its U.S. run with around $822K. Similarly, Akhil Akkineni’s latest release Lenin is also heading towards a very similar finish, having already crossed $823K.

#Lenin may add another $1 to $2K if there are pending Indian theater reports, which usually happens. But both films closing around the $820K mark is a rare coincidence, especially considering they are the latest releases of the Akkineni brothers.

On a serious note, while Akhil showed some promise with #Lenin, the Akkineni family, including Nagarjuna, has been struggling to make a strong impact in the crucial North America market.

The U.S. market has become an important factor in determining a film’s overall success, and the Akkineni heroes have a lot of ground to cover to regain their stronghold.
